The Glyphs panel lets you insert glyphs into your text by choosing the appropriate option from the menu on the left side of the screen. The Glyphs panel displays glyphs based on the font in which your cursor is currently located. You can change the font or typestyle and narrow down the list to just include punctuation symbols using the option under the Entire Font. When you move your cursor over the glyph, you will see its CID/GID and Unicode value in a tooltip.

After you've entered a few glyphs and then the Glyphs panel will keep track of the last 35 distinct ones you've used and make them available under the category of Recently Used on the first row of the panel (you need to expand the panel in order to see all 35). You can also clear this list by right-clicking or Control-clicking a glyph in the list and choosing Remove From Recent Glyphs.

Recycled Items

The magic happens when you use the third "R," recycling. You can benefit the environment by recycling a product made of recycled materials. This is because the majority of products that are recycled are returned to their original manufacturer to be remanufactured to create a new product. This is referred to as "closing the loop of recycling."

When a person places something in their recycling bin at the curb it is taken to a Materials Recovery Facility (MRF) where it is separated and sorted into different components. Then it is offered to manufacturers at the end of the line to make something completely new. Items that are usually transformed into new products include:

This reduces the necessity to harvest, cultivate or extract raw materials to create something other than. In turn, this decreases the amount of harm that is done to the natural world as fewer trees are removed and rivers diverted, and wild animals are relocated. This also reduces the amount of pollution caused by dumping raw material into our soil, water and air.

As an added bonus, purchasing recycled products help keep local businesses and jobs alive, especially those that specialize in the production of goods made using recycled materials. The demand for recycled products encourages businesses to participate in this environmentally friendly effort.

A final reason to purchase recycled products is that it takes less energy to produce new products from recycled materials than it does to make them from raw materials.
